Understanding Technesis Components and Relationships This section helps you become familiar with the roles of key components in the Technesis Print Control System and gives you insight on how they work together to produce the industry s most technologically-advanced print management system. TechnesisConsole The Technesis Console is the single control point for the entire Technesis system. From here, you can configure: Devices Projects Phases Bill Types & Rates Media And More! TechnesisiBridge The Technesis Console streamlines print management administration by automatically passing data between its databases and other components of the system for accurate, comprehensive document output management and cost TechnesisClient recovery. Technesis ibridge enables the print management system to integrate with APIenabled output devices (or output controller for other devices). This allows job data to automatically flow into the Technesis Database without the need for additional hardware (like release devices). Technesis ibridge allows direct access to job logs of individual devices to provide as printed data. This is a more accurate solution than recording data as TechnesisConsole TechnesisSmartSync TechnesisiBridge TechnesisClient TechnesisSmartSync submitted at the desktop or print server level. Example: If a 20-page document is submitted through a network print server but cancelled after the first page is printed, as submitted data records 20 pages printed, whereas as printed data correctly identifies the printing of just a single page.

TechnesisClient TechnesisSmartSync Technesis SmartSync provides allows this solution to be tightly integrated into most ODBC-compliant systems, including ERPs, accounting and billing systems. This means current user codes, project codes, project IDs and end user information can be pulled into your Technesis Print Control System.
